deep breathsโ€œFor every win / Someone must fail / But there comes a point when / When we exhale.โ€  Iconic R&B and pop singer ๐ŸŽ™ Whitney Houston had an extraordinary run with soundtracks in the 1990s.  Sure, she released two studio albums โ€“ ๐Ÿ’ฟ Iโ€™m Your Baby Tonight (1990) and ๐Ÿ’ฟ My Love Is Your Love (1998) โ€“ but there were three key soundtracks she was part of, including ๐Ÿ’ฟ Waiting to Exhale (1995). Her key contribution to Waiting to Exhale is the no. 1 hit, ๐ŸŽต โ€œExhale (Shoop Shoop)โ€, written by the one and only ๐ŸŽผโœ Babyface.  This is Babyface contributing top-notch songwriting and Whitney Houston at her best.

sounds goudaโ€œExhale (Shoop Shoop)โ€ is a quintessential 90s classic.  It perfectly captures the adult contemporary R&B vibes of the time.  Houston sings incredibly, delivering an emotional, expressive performance.  Why does this exhalation need to happen? Heartbreak, of course โ€“ itโ€™s a beast! The three verses are incredible (โ€œWhen you got friends to wish you well / Youโ€™ll find a point when / You will exhaleโ€), but itโ€™s that sing-along chorus, with all those โ€œshoops,โ€ that steals the show.  Houston, of course, makes it sound effortless.

Final Thoughts ๐Ÿ’ญ

classicIf you had a black soundtrack in the 1990s, you know youโ€™d betta call Whitney Houston โ€“ she unleashed straight-up magic.  Itโ€™s not surprising that โ€œExhale (Shoop Shooop)โ€ was a surefire gem that would ultimately win a ๐Ÿ† Grammy.  Notably, ๐ŸŽ™ Robin Thicke released a cover  in 2012.  Heโ€™s not the only one to cover this certified classic.
